| plant assets | Assets taht will be used for a number of years in the operation of a business. |
| real property | Land and anything attached to the land. |
| personal property | All property not classified as real property. |
| assessed value | The value of an asset determined by tax authorities for the purpose of calculating taxes. |
| estimated salvage value | The amount the business expects to receive when a plant asset is removed from use. |
| estimated useful life | The nubmer of years a plant asset is expected to be used. |
| accumulated depreciation | The amount of depreciation expense of a plant asset's useful life. |
| book value of a plant asset | The original cost of a plant asset minus accumulated depreciation. |
| plant asset record | An accounting form on which a business records information about each plant asset. |
| gain on plant assets | Revenue that results when a plant asset is sold for more than book value. |
| loss on plant assets | The loss that results when a plant asset is sold for less than book value. |
| declining-balance method of depreciation | Multiplying the book value by a constant depreciation rate at the end of each fiscal period. |
| straight-line method of depreciation | Charging an equal amount of depreciation expense in each full year in which the asset is used. |
